Before we go into the ways To Remove Moles, we must first define what a mole is and how it comes about. Moles on the skin are actually caused by skin cells called melanocytes. Moles are known medically as nevi. They are nothing more than clusters of pigmented cells. These cells produce melanin and this is the factor that accounts for the color of our skin, eyes and hair. Normally, melanin is distributed evenly, but sometimes melanocytes grow together in a cluster, giving rise to moles. They can also appear virtually anywhere on the body. They can also vary in color and sizes. They can be smooth or wrinkled, flat or raised.

Moles normally are present at birth and in many cases they appear as a person grows older. The few factors that cause the formation of moles include, age, exposure to sunlight, heredity as well as hormonal changes. Most people have between 20 and 40 moles throughout the body although the number may change throughout life.

We should be unduly worried by moles but if you are above 20 years old, and suddenly you find a mole appearing out of nowhere, you need to be concerned. Check for the following symptoms including the sudden difference in shape, size, color and elevation, scaly and crusty, painful, burning and itching sensation. Lastly check whether it is bleeding for no apparent reason. Should these symptoms become real, you should see your doctor or a Dermatologist for a thorough follow-up.

Usually large moles that appear at birth may increase the risk of it developing into deadly form of skin cancer called malignant melanoma. The next type of mole that is prone to develop into cancer is moles that are larger than 6 millimeters. They looked like fried eggs dark brown centers and lighter, uneven borders.

As part of preventive medical care, you can choose to see your doctor and having you thoroughly examined for moles that may be cancerous. He or she can take a tissue sample for biopsy. Early cancer detection is very important. Where the moles are benign, then if need be or for cosmetic reason, you can always have them removed. There are many methods to remove moles and these include excision, cryosurgery and laser therapy…
